After the rebellion, Owain Glyndŵr, the Welsh leader who led a revolt against English rule in the early 15th century, became a fugitive. Following a series of victories, his rebellion ultimately faltered due to internal divisions and military setbacks. Owain disappeared from historical records around 1421, and his fate remains unclear; he is believed to have lived in hiding for the rest of his life, with some legends suggesting he may have died in obscurity. Despite his defeat, he has since become a symbol of Welsh nationalism and pride.
